We've been the past 3 Februarys. Love it! It's warmer the later in February you go, but you'll still have a blast. There's a fabulous park you must go to called Xel Ha Eco Park. It's kind of expensive to get in but it's so worth it to go once. You can spend the day there. Check it out here http://www.cancuntravel.com/xelha.asp. It's just a little bit south of Playa del Carmen. In Playa there's lots of shopping and restaurants on 5th Avenue (you can just walk from one end to the other) and there's a ferry that goes over to Cozumel. You should go to the ruins in Tulum. Are you renting a car or are you staying in an all inclusive? We always rent a house in Playacar. We fly into Cancun, rent a car and drive to Playa del Carmen.
